Peer reviewedHarris, Alma; Hopkins, David – School Leadership & Management, 2000
In UK schools, improvement is demanded and expected. The 10-year-old Quality of Education for All project, emphasizing both structural and cultural change at the school level, has achieved demonstrable success in diverse school contexts. Insights on the theory, process, and practice of school improvement are discussed. (MLH)

Peer reviewedHopkins, David; Youngman, Mick; Harris, Alma; Wordsworth, Judith – Journal of Research in Reading, 1999
Reports on the initial implementation of the Success For All (SFA) reading/school improvement program in inner city primary schools in Nottingham, England. Finds students made as much progress in one term in reading as they would normally make in one year; and their motivation, behavior, attitude to and skills in learning also increased. (RS)
